Explosions at Jakarta School Mosque Injure 54, Panic Ensues

BREAKING: Multiple explosions rocked a mosque at SMA 27 high school in Jakarta, Indonesia, during Friday prayers, injuring at least 54 people, primarily students. The blasts occurred around 12 PM local time, just as the sermon began, sending worshippers into a panic amidst the chaos.

Witnesses reported hearing at least two loud explosions as grey smoke filled the mosque located within a navy compound in the Kelapa Gading neighborhood. The immediate aftermath saw students and others fleeing, with many suffering cuts and injuries from flying glass shards.

Jakarta Police Chief Asep Edi Suheri confirmed that while the cause of the explosions remains unknown, investigators found toy rifles and a toy gun near the mosque’s loudspeaker. Authorities have dispatched an anti-bomb squad to the scene, intensifying the investigation to determine whether this incident was an attack.

“Police are still investigating the scene to determine the cause of the blasts,” Suheri stated. He urged the public to refrain from speculation until the investigation concludes, emphasizing, “Let the authorities work first. We will convey whatever the results are to the public.”

In the wake of the explosions, injured individuals were quickly transported to nearby hospitals. While some patients have been discharged, 20 students remain hospitalized, with three suffering from serious injuries, according to Suheri.
